The Problem with Generic Ductwork

Standard pre-fabricated ductwork may seem like a convenient solution, but it often leads to significant problems:

  • **Leaks that waste energy** and drive up utility bills
  • **Inconsistent temperatures** across different rooms and areas
  • **Systems working harder than necessary**, leading to premature wear and costly repairs
  • **Poor airflow** that leaves some rooms too hot and others too cold

Generic ducts are built to approximate sizes. But every home and commercial space is different. When ductwork doesn't fit your space precisely, your HVAC system pays the price.

Why Custom Sheet Metal Makes the Difference

Custom-fabricated sheet metal ductwork is designed and built specifically for your space. Our team measures, designs, and fabricates each piece to ensure a perfect fit. The benefits are significant:

  • **Improved airflow**: Your system delivers comfort evenly throughout the building, eliminating hot and cold spots
  • **Enhanced energy efficiency**: Properly sealed, custom-fitted ducts reduce energy loss, lowering your monthly utility expenses
  • **Extended system lifespan**: When your HVAC system doesn't have to work overtime compensating for poor ductwork, it lasts longer and requires fewer repairs
  • **Quieter operation**: Well-fitted ducts eliminate rattling, whistling, and other noise issues

When to Consider Ductwork Replacement

If you're experiencing any of these signs, your ductwork may need attention:

  • **Uneven temperatures** from room to room
  • **Excessive dust** in your home despite regular cleaning
  • **Rising energy bills** without changes in usage
  • **Visible damage** such as dents, rust, or disconnected joints
  • **Your system is over 15 years old** and ducts have never been replaced
